What is the difference between Full Time Capital Raising vs Full Time Investment Analyst?

AspectFull Time Capital RaisingFull Time Investment Analyst
Primary FocusSecuring funding, investor relations, fundraising strategiesAnalyzing investment opportunities, financial modeling, market research
Required SkillsCommunication, networking, understanding of capital marketsFinancial analysis, valuation, Excel proficiency
Work EnvironmentInvestor meetings, pitch presentations, client interactionsResearch, data analysis, report writing
CertificationsOften requires finance or related certifications, but less formalOften requires CFA, CPA, or similar credentials

While both roles operate within the finance industry, Full Time Capital Raising focuses on securing funding and managing investor relationships, whereas Full Time Investment Analysts analyze financial data to support investment decisions. The roles differ in daily tasks, skill requirements, and focus areas, though they share some financial knowledge and industry familiarity.

What are some common challenges faced in a full-time capital raising role and how can they be addressed?

Professionals in full-time capital raising often encounter challenges such as building trust with potential investors, navigating regulatory requirements, and differentiating their firm's offerings in a competitive market. Success in this role typically relies on strong relationship-building skills, thorough understanding of investment products, and clear, transparent communication. Staying updated on compliance standards and proactively addressing investor concerns can help overcome these obstacles and foster long-term partnerships.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ive in Full Time Capital Raising, and why are they important?

To thrive in Full Time Capital Raising, you need strong financial analysis skills, in-depth knowledge of investment products, and a background in finance, business, or economics. Familiarity with CRM software, financial modeling tools, and relevant certifications such as CFA or Series 7/63 is often required. Exceptional communication, networking abilities, and persuasive negotiation skills set top professionals apart. These competencies are crucial for building investor relationships, effectively communicating value propositions, and achieving fundraising goals.

What is full time capital raising?

Full time capital raising refers to the professional role of seeking and securing investment or funding for a business, fund, or project on a continuous basis. Individuals in this position typically work for investment firms, startups, private equity, or real estate firms, and are responsible for building relationships with investors, preparing presentations, and managing the fundraising process. The job requires strong communication, networking, and financial analysis skills, as well as a deep understanding of the investment landscape. Success in this role can directly impact a company’s ability to grow and pursue new opportunities.

Analyst, Capital Solutions

Capital Solutions is a newly formed team within the Capital Markets division of Capital One's Commercial Bank. Capital One Commercial Bank, a top 10 U.S. commercial bank, offers a comprehensive range of investment banking services, including Equity Capital Markets, Debt Capital Markets, Loan Syndications, Structured Products, Mergers and Acquisitions, Derivatives, and Equity Sales, Research, and Trading.

The Capital Solutions team provides specialized capital-raising and capital-markets advisory services to private equity sponsors and their portfolio companies and at times corporate clients. Our mandate spans the full suite of private-market solutions, including:

  • Sponsor-Led Secondary Solutions: Advisory and execution for continuation vehicles, fund restructurings, and liquidity solutions for private equity sponsors looking to extend holding periods for trophy assets.

  • Co-Investments & Structured Equity: Advisory and execution for co-investment opportunities, covering common equity, preferred equity, and junior debt financing structures.

  • Bespoke Financing: Highly tailored capital-raising strategies, leveraging deep investor relationships and bespoke structuring expertise to deliver optimal financing outcomes.

The individual will be a registered representative of Capital One Securities.

KEY RESPONSIBILITIES
  • Pitch & Deal Execution: Support the origination and execution of capital-raising and private placement transactions, including the drafting of pitch books, presentations, and proposal materials.

  • Financial Modeling & Valuation: Build, maintain, and update complex financial models, valuation analyses (DCF, trading comps, precedent transactions), and company/fund performance analyses.

  • Marketing Material Creation: Develop institutional-grade marketing materials, including Confidential Information Memorandums (CIMs), teasers, and management presentations.

  • Investor Log Management: Assist in designing investor targeting lists and manage the tracking of investor engagement, NDAs, questions, and feedback throughout the placement process.

  • Data Room & Due Diligence: Build, organize, and manage virtual data rooms (VDRs) to facilitate due diligence processes for prospective institutional investors.

  • Content Maintenance: Ensure all internal tracking databases, team credentials, and market data repository files are continuously updated.
